EPS Corporation is seeking a Material Handling Laborer that Operates Material Handling Equipment (MHE) for Property Accountability Services (PAS) operations at NUWCDIVNPT warehouse facilities. Performs physical material handling including receiving, warehousing, delivery, and packaging operations using forklifts and pallet jacks for SUBSAFE/LEVEL I/DSS-SOC material.

Operate Government-provided MHE including pallet jacks and forklifts (up to 36,000 lb. capacity).
Perform MHE inspection prior to and immediately after operation.
Report operational or safety issues to Government Lead; do not operate MHE until issues are resolved.
Maintain all required OSHA certifications and forklift training.
Offload material from delivery vehicles using MHE.
Transport material from receiving to storage locations.
Support material receipt, validation, and labeling operations.
Store material per Government Location Schema using MHE.
Perform re-warehousing, stock rotation, and warehouse maintenance.
Assemble, install, and maintain storage aids (racks, bins, pallets).
Maintain warehouse orderly, clean, and safe; operate Government-provided Zamboni for floor cleaning.
Perform COSIS processes; protect material from damage, deterioration, or pilferage.
Perform packing, packaging, physical handling, loading, and movement of material from staging area to delivery truck.
Deliver material per priority timelines:
Priority 01-03: within 24 hours of receipt
Priority 04-15/no priority/WMF: within 72 hours of receipt
WMF material: by Required Delivery Date (RDD)
Obtain customer signatures on WMFs, update delivery manifest.
Capable of lifting up to 70 pounds.
Perform preservation, packaging, packing, and marking on items of various sizes and weights.
Visually inspect material and containers for transport suitability.
Review CIIC and classification markings; utilize special handling precautions when applicable.
Pack classified, pilferable, and sensitive material within secure storage areas.

Qualifications:
High School Diploma or Equivalent.
Possesses current and valid OSHA certification for forklift operator up to 15K lbs. for forklift types, Class I-V and VII.
One year of demonstrated experience operating Material Handling Equipment (MHE) in a warehouse environment.
Desired Qualifications/Experience:
SUBSAFE/LEVEL I/DSS-SOC material handling experience.
DoD warehouse operations.
MIL-STD-129R (Military Marking for Shipment and Storage).
MIL-STD-2073-1E (Military Packaging).
Hazardous and classified material handling.
